Paper Abstract
This paper provides the detail design of a navigation computer, which is designed specifically for an integrated
SINS/GPS navigation system. According to the function of the navigation computer, the design is described in three
modules: data acquisition module, signal processing module, and communication module respectively. The navigation
computer system selects TMS320VC33 as its CPU and ADS1217 as its A/D convertor. With the powerful Digital Signal
Processor and highly precise A/D convertor, it is demonstrated through experiment that the precision of data acquisition
module is 16 bits, meanwhile, the time used for completing the whole SINS algorithm is less than 1ms.
